Import of Homogenised Preparations of Jams, Fruit Jellies, Marmalades, Fruit or Nut Puree and Fruit or Nut Pastes

This key economic indicator for the Jam sector has been recently updated.

  1. In 2019, Import of Homogenised Preparations of Jams, Fruit Jellies, Marmalades, Fruit or Nut Puree and Fruit or Nut Pastes to Sweden rose 7.8% compared to the previous year.
  2. Since 2014 Italy Import of Homogenised Preparations of Jams, Fruit Jellies, Marmalades, Fruit or Nut Puree and Fruit or Nut Pastes was up 25% year on year reaching €17,132,880.98.
  3. In 2019 Germany was number 1 in Import of Homogenised Preparations of Jams, Fruit Jellies, Marmalades, Fruit or Nut Puree and Fruit or Nut Pastes.
  4. In 2019 Sweden was ranked number 2 in Import of Homogenised Preparations of Jams, Fruit Jellies, Marmalades, Fruit or Nut Puree and Fruit or Nut Pastes at €17,490,255.11, compared to 5 in 2018.
